Dell plans IPO to enhance its bought out SecureWorks' valuation

Dell is mulling over an initial public offer (IPO) for its recently acquired SecureWorks. Dell is also planning to spin off SecureWorks after the IPO which is expected to enhance the valuation of SecureWorks from $154.9 million $1.4 billion.

As IPO market recovers, more retailers set to list in London- report
With a recovery in the IPO market propelling private equity backers to exit their investments, lenders are readying to list more UK retailers on the London bourse, the Financial Times reported.
As private equity buyers exit investments, Goldman Sachs sees wave of South African listings
Goldman Sachs Group Inc is predicting a flood of initial public offerings to be held in South Africa as private equity buyers divest their investments, Bloomberg reported.

AAG Energy considers reviving Hong Kong IPO
China-based coal bed methane producer AAG Energy Ltd may revive its plan for an initial public offering (IPO) in Hong Kong which was shelved last year, to raise funds for its 2014 operations.
Ingenious Media Holdings plans $262M IPO of clean energy-focused unit
Ingenious Media Holdings Plc has planned a £160 million or $262 million initial public offering for Ingenious Clean Energy Income Plc, its unit that invests in clean energy, Bloomberg reported.

China-based diaper maker AAB Group files application for $300M Hong Kong IPO- sources
AAB Group Co, a diaper manufacturer based in China, has filed an application to hold a $300 million initial public offering in Hong Kong, sources interviewed by Bloomberg revealed.
US software maker Zendesk to launch IPO in 2014
San Francisco, California-based customer-tracking software maker Zendesk has sought the services of Goldman Sachs to lead a potential initial public offering (IPO) set later this year.
